The Parallax RoHS Compliant SX28AC/SS-G is a RISC architecture, high-speed microcontroller with flash program memory, in-system programming and debugging capability. Operating at frequencies up to 75 MHz with an optimized single-cycle instruction set, developers can implement real-time functions as software modules. Common examples include communication interfaces (I2C, SPI, UARTs), frequency generation and measurement, PWM, and sigma-delta A/D. The on-chip functions of the SX28AC/SS-G include a general-purpose 8-bit timer, an analog comparator, watchdog timer, a power-save mode with wakeup capability, a configurable internal oscillator and high-current outputs.
